
OpenAI plans to build humanoid robots. The company is hiring for robotics operations.
This could give it more control over AI development.
It also brings competition with Figure and Tesla.
What happened
OpenAI CEO Sam Altman said in an August 26 TIME interview that OpenAI would “definitely” make humanoid robots. A job posting visible as of September 6 describes an effort integrating hardware and software across multiple robot forms.
Why it matters
Building the body could give OpenAI more control over how its intelligence is developed and deployed. It would also bring responsibility for the machinery that turns a model’s decisions into movement, and could support a cycle of collecting training data, revising models, and testing on the same hardware.
What to watch
A complete OpenAI humanoid would bring it into more direct competition with Figure and Tesla. The posting does not establish a release date, a shipping product, or the program’s size or output.

OpenAI’s move into humanoid robotics marks a shift beyond software, aiming to build physical systems around its intelligence. The company sees potential benefits in controlling how its models act in the world and in gathering training data from physical tasks. However, the announcement is preliminary, with no product or timeline specified.
Figure’s February 2025 Helix announcement illustrates the challenges and opportunities. Figure described an architecture separating visual and language processing from motor control, and reported about 500 hours of teleoperated training data. These are Figure’s own claims, not independently verified, but they show how robot learning depends on examples of physical action.
For OpenAI, owning a robot platform could enable a similar cycle: collect observations and actions, revise models, and test on the same hardware. Yet the hiring description does not confirm a deployed fleet or proprietary data. Whether this leads to better robot performance remains uncertain, as do questions about safety, manufacturing, and timing. Direct competition with Figure and Tesla is likely, but readiness levels are unclear.
